The Dehydrating Paradox: Why Soda Isn't a Substitute for Water
It may seem like drinking soda is a form of hydration, but several factors prove otherwise. Many sodas contain diuretics—ingredients that increase urine production and fluid loss. This creates a paradoxical situation where consuming the beverage can actually lead to increased dehydration.
The Role of Caffeine and Sugar
- Caffeine: A common ingredient in many colas and other sodas, caffeine is a mild diuretic. While its diuretic effect is not extreme in moderate amounts, regular, heavy consumption contributes to fluid loss over time.
- High Sugar Content: Excess sugar forces the kidneys and liver to work harder to process and excrete it, requiring additional water. This draw of fluid from your system further exacerbates dehydration, leaving you with a continuous feeling of thirst that soda can't genuinely quench.
The Impact of Sugar Overload and Dehydration on Internal Organs
The combination of high sugar intake and chronic dehydration puts immense strain on your body, particularly on your metabolic and renal systems.
Liver Stress and Non-Alcoholic Fatty Liver Disease (NAFLD)
The fructose in sugary sodas is processed primarily by the liver. Consuming large amounts overwhelms the liver, causing it to convert the excess sugar into fat. Over time, this can lead to non-alcoholic fatty liver disease (NAFLD), a condition that can progress to severe liver scarring (cirrhosis).
Kidney Strain and Disease Risk
The kidneys are responsible for filtering waste and regulating fluid balance. The constant influx of sugar and potential dehydration from soda forces the kidneys to overwork. Studies have linked high sugar-sweetened beverage consumption with an increased risk of chronic kidney disease and kidney stones. The phosphoric acid found in many dark colas can also contribute to this strain.
A Systemic Breakdown: Broader Health Concerns
Beyond the primary organs, excessive soda consumption and insufficient water intake have systemic consequences that affect nearly every part of the body.
- Dental Decay: Soda's combination of sugar and acid is highly damaging to teeth. The acid erodes tooth enamel, while the sugar feeds bacteria that produce more enamel-destroying acid, leading to cavities and decay. This damage is irreversible and can lead to tooth loss.
- Metabolic Syndrome and Type 2 Diabetes: The rapid and repeated spikes in blood sugar from soda can cause insulin resistance, a key driver of metabolic syndrome. This significantly increases the risk of developing type 2 diabetes. Regular consumption of even just one can per day has been linked to a higher risk.
- Weight Gain: Liquid calories from soda don't provide the same feeling of fullness as solid food, leading to higher overall caloric intake and weight gain. Studies have consistently shown a link between frequent sugary drink consumption and obesity.
- Bone Health: Some sodas contain phosphoric acid, which can interfere with the body's ability to absorb calcium. This, combined with replacing calcium-rich beverages like milk with soda, can lead to weakened bones and a higher risk of osteoporosis.
Comparing Hydration Sources: Soda vs. Water
| Feature | Water | Sugary Soda | Diet Soda |
|---|---|---|---|
| Hydration | Excellent. Essential for all body functions. | Poor. Diuretic effect can worsen dehydration. | Can hydrate, but offers no nutritional benefit. |
| Sugar | None. | High added sugar content, often high-fructose corn syrup. | None, but contains artificial sweeteners. |
| Calories | Zero. | High, with all calories from sugar. | Zero, but may increase cravings. |
| Nutritional Value | Contains essential minerals and is vital for health. | None. Empty calories only. | None. Contains chemicals instead of sugar. |
| Dental Impact | Neutralizes acids and protects teeth. | High acid and sugar content severely damages enamel. | High acidity can also erode enamel. |
| Chronic Disease Risk | Reduces risk by supporting organ function. | Significantly increases risk of diabetes, heart, and kidney disease. | May also increase risk for some metabolic issues. |
